Exemple #1
0
$tHeader->addAction('postingData', 'Posting', 'images/' . $_SESSION['theme'] . "/posting.png");
$tHeader->_actions[2]->setAltImg('images/' . $_SESSION['theme'] . "/posted.png");
if (!in_array($_SESSION['empl']['kodejabatan'], $postJabatan)) {
    $tHeader->_actions[2]->_name = '';
}
$tHeader->addAction('detailPDF', 'Print Data Detail', 'images/' . $_SESSION['theme'] . "/pdf.jpg");
$tHeader->_actions[3]->addAttr('event');
$tHeader->_actions[3]->addAttr($tipeVal);
$tHeader->addAction('detailData', 'Print Data Detail', 'images/' . $_SESSION['theme'] . "/zoom.png");
$tHeader->_actions[4]->addAttr('event');
$tHeader->_actions[4]->addAttr($tipeVal);
$tHeader->addAction('detailExcel', 'Print Data Detail', 'images/excel.jpg');
$tHeader->_actions[5]->addAttr('event');
$tHeader->_actions[5]->addAttr($tipeVal);
$tHeader->pageSetting(1, $totalRow, 10);
$tHeader->setWhere($whereContArr);
//$tHeader->_switchException = array();
$tHeader->_switchException = array('detailData', 'detailPDF', 'detailExcel');
//$tHeader->addAction('detailPDF','Print Data Detail','images/'.$_SESSION['theme']."/pdf.jpg");
//$tHeader->_actions[3]->addAttr('event');
//$tHeader->pageSetting(1,$totalRow,10);
//$tHeader->setWhere($whereContArr);
//$tHeader->_switchException = array('detailPDF');
#echo "<pre>";
#print_r($tHeader);
#=== Display View
# Title & Control
OPEN_BOX();
echo "<div align='center'><h3>" . $_SESSION['lang']['panen'] . "</h3></div>";
echo "<div><table align='center'><tr>";
foreach ($ctl as $el) {
     $tHeader->addAction('deleteData', 'Delete', 'images/' . $_SESSION['theme'] . "/delete.png");
     $tHeader->addAction('postingData', 'Posting', 'images/' . $_SESSION['theme'] . "/posting.png");
     $tHeader->_actions[2]->setAltImg('images/' . $_SESSION['theme'] . "/posted.png");
     $tHeader->addAction('detailPDF', 'Print Voucher', 'images/' . $_SESSION['theme'] . "/pdf.jpg");
     if (!in_array($_SESSION['empl']['kodejabatan'], $postJabatan) and $_SESSION['empl']['tipelokasitugas'] != 'HOLDING') {
         $tHeader->_actions[2]->_name = '';
     }
     $tHeader->_actions[3]->addAttr('event');
     $tHeader->pageSetting($param['page'], $totalRow, $param['shows']);
     $tHeader->addAction('tampilDetail', 'Print Data Detail', 'images/' . $_SESSION['theme'] . "/zoom.png");
     $tHeader->_actions[4]->addAttr('event');
     $tHeader->addAction('detailPDF2', 'Print Bukti Pembayaran', 'images/' . $_SESSION['theme'] . "/pdf.jpg");
     $tHeader->_actions[5]->addAttr('event');
     $tHeader->_switchException = array('detailPDF', 'detailPDF2', 'tampilDetail');
     if (isset($param['where'])) {
         $tHeader->setWhere($arrWhere);
     }
     $tHeader->setAlign($align);
     # View
     $tHeader->renderTable();
     break;
     # Form Add Header
 # Form Add Header
 case 'showAdd':
     // View
     echo formHeader('add', array());
     echo "<div id='detailField' style='clear:both'></div>";
     break;
     # Form Edit Header
 # Form Edit Header
 case 'showEdit':